Worx Hydroshot, model WG629. Just looking to clean the bugs off the front of our c class when we arrive at our spot. This thing can draw water from a bucket, the lake, a garden hose. Only around 300 PSI, various spray patterns, small, light, easy to pack, quiet, cordless. Looks like the answer to me? around $150.00CDN Any feedback would be great.

I bought one a couple of months ago. Very handy in freezing weather. Have used it on car and RV and various things around the house that would have waited for months to be washed.
I use a 5 gallon bucket for the water source with warm water.
Not the same as a real wash but gets a lot of stuff off including most of whatever Pennsylvania is using on the roads this winter.
Should work for fresh bug kill, not sure about baked on.
I am very satisfied.
One tip, it takes awhile to draw water from the bucket through the hose to the nozzle. I quickly learned to hold the wand about the same height as the bucket and it then draws the water quickly.
